As an Injury Management Specialist, you will play a vital role in helping individuals return to work and regain their independence.

About the Role
  • Provide expert guidance to assist injured clients and their employers with safe and sustainable return-to-work outcomes.
  • Maintain high-quality services across customers as per Service Level Agreement (SLA) requirements.
  • Conduct thorough assessments of worksites, functional areas, ergonomics, equipment, and home environments to identify potential hazards and develop effective solutions.
  • Liaise with clients, insurers, medical professionals, and employers to achieve mutually beneficial outcomes.
  • Implement rehabilitation services tailored to individual needs, focusing on customer satisfaction and long-term success.
  • Represent your organisation at public forums and contribute to various committees as required.
Qualifications and Skills
  • Australian recognised degree qualification and full Accreditation in Occupational Therapy, Exercise Physiology, Chiropractic or Physiotherapy.
  • Strong verbal and written communication skills, with the ability to build rapport with diverse stakeholders.
  • Exceptional interpersonal skills, enabling effective collaboration and negotiation.
  • Determination to consistently provide exceptional customer service, with a focus on delivering results-driven solutions.
  • A keen sense of punctuality and time management, ensuring efficient use of resources and meeting deadlines.
